Ray Nagin is an American politician who served as the Mayor of New Orleans from 2002 to 2010. His tenure included the critical period of Hurricane Katrina and its aftermath, during which he faced significant challenges in managing the city's recovery and rebuilding efforts. Nagin's leadership during this crisis was both praised and criticized, making him a notable figure in the context of urban disaster management and recovery.
